| Rank | Player | Position | D | DE% | ED |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Serene Watson | DEF | 258 | 78% | 200 |
| 2 | Zippy Fish | MID | 254 | 74% | 189 |
| 3 | Niamh McLaughlin | DEF | 280 | 73% | 204 |
| 4 | Mikayla Bowen | FWD | 259 | 70% | 181 |
| 5 | Jasmine Garner | MID | 297 | 68% | 201 |
| 6 | Ash Riddell | MID | 444 | 67% | 297 |
| 7 | Tyla Hanks | MID | 291 | 66% | 193 |
| 8 | Rebecca Beeson | MID | 258 | 66% | 170 |
| 9 | Tilly Lucas-Rodd | DEF | 254 | 66% | 167 |
| 10 | Georgie Prespakis | MID | 310 | 64% | 197 |
| 11 | Eliza West | MID | 272 | 63% | 172 |
| 12 | Monique Conti | MID | 316 | 63% | 199 |
| 13 | Gabrielle Newton | MID | 293 | 63% | 184 |
| 14 | Charlie Rowbottom | MID | 304 | 62% | 188 |
| 15 | Georgia Nanscawen | MID | 280 | 59% | 165 |
| 16 | Dayna Finn | MID | 275 | 58% | 160 |
| 17 | Alexandra Anderson | MID | 299 | 58% | 172 |
| 18 | Brittany Bonnici | MID | 257 | 57% | 147 |
| 19 | Laura Gardiner | MID | 380 | 57% | 215 |
| 20 | Ella Roberts | MID | 256 | 57% | 145 |
| 21 | Zarlie Goldsworthy | FWD | 254 | 56% | 143 |
| 22 | Ebony Marinoff | MID | 334 | 56% | 187 |
| 23 | Elizabeth McNamara | MID | 258 | 55% | 143 |
| 24 | Aisling McCarthy | MID | 292 | 53% | 154 |
| 25 | Madison Prespakis | MID | 258 | 53% | 136 |
| 26 | Kiara Bowers | MID | 256 | 51% | 130 |

Ash Riddell (Norf) wins the League BnF by 3 votes, ahead of the other Prespakis.
Essendon Leaderboard
G. Nanscawen - 13 votes
S. Cain & M. Prespakis - 3 votes
A. Gaylor and M. MacLachlan - 2 votes
G. Gee - 1 vote
